Subject: Handover — consent banner rollout

Hi Marisol,

The Bramblewick consent banner schema changes are merged and the feature flag sits at 10%. Audit rows are writing cleanly; no lock contention so far. Please review the retention trigger before we widen the flag tomorrow. You can verify against staging with the connection string below.

primary connection of yagep-kahip = redis://giliel_svc:zYiKsLL2PLpfPL@db-348f.xolmarsys.corp:5432/fenwyn

## Deployment

Search relevance tuning for Quillhaven's catalog index ships with this release. We rebalanced the title-boost weights after last week's regression, where partial matches on brand names outranked exact SKU hits. The new scoring profile favors exact-phrase matches and demotes stale listings older than 90 days. Deploys go through the staging ring first; give the index thirty minutes to warm before comparing metrics. The values below reflect what staging currently runs and what production should match after rollout.

service settings:
[casax]
port = 6379
team = rusir
host = casax.zemvarhq.corp
region = outer-4
access_code = ac_9808ce
timeout_ms = 1500

Handover — from Director Okafor-Linn to Director Brask

For the sales leads at Meridale Fixtures: we've locked 60% of projected eastern-market receipts under forward contracts through Q3. Rationale: the velsmark has swung 9% in six weeks and margin on the Orlan range can't absorb that. Pricing sheets already reflect hedged rates — do not discount past floor without treasury sign-off. Brask owns the roll-forward decision in October; sales leads should flag any large multi-currency deals early. One strategic note below, keep it tight.

board note of kageg-bahof: The renewal with Holwynax Holdings closes at $2 million a year, 5 percent below the last contract. Project Ulaath slips by two quarters because of the supplier delay.

## DeployPing Bot — On-Call Quickstart

DeployPing posts deploy status to the #ship-status channel. Commands: `status`, `last`, `rollback-check`. It reads from the Larkspur pipeline only; staging is not covered.

If the bot goes silent, restart it via the Ops console. If the console rejects your session, use the break-glass recovery flow. Enter the recovery passphrase exactly as written below.

unlock words, hahip-baduf: holwyn-istath-julvan